Hi,

Thanks for posting a pic of it; I've been waiting to see one show up somewhere.

You can't see it from the picture, but it also has a dual recoil spring instead of the single spring. Supposed to soak up recoil a bit better.

The mag release is supposed to be reversible although a different design than the one Glock introduced not long ago. This design is supposed to use the old style side cut in the magazine and not that small rectangle cut in the front middle of the mag. I guess the new mags will have the side cut on both sides. The mag release looks a bit big to me.

I'm glad they abandoned the fish scale looking slide serrations. I thought they were hideous.

I think it will say gen4 on the slide.

I doubt they did this, but I'd really like to know if that slide is a little heavier/wider/beefier than a standard 22 slide...

Or also whether any frame changes were made to help the light malfunction issues people have experienced with 22's and 23's.
